> While running networktest for nfs; nfsstress &  nfsstat01 test gets
> fail. Because TCbin is not exported with required path. Following
> patch fixed the above problem.
>
Signed-off-by:  Sumit Dhoot <[email protected]>

=======

> Index: ltp-full-20100630/runtest/nfs
> ===================================================================
> --- ltp-full-20100630.orig/runtest/nfs
> +++ ltp-full-20100630/runtest/nfs
> @@ -6,10 +6,10 @@ nfs01 export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=
>  nfs02 export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in nfs02
>  nfs03 export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in nfs03
>  nfs04 export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in nfs04
> -nfslock01 export VERSION; nfslock01
> +nfslock01 export VERSION;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in nfslock01
>
>  # This will run 1 thread on 20 directories with 50 files in each.
> -nfsstress export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; nfsstress 20 50 1
> +nfsstress export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in
> nfsstress 20 50 1
>
>  nfsstat01 export VERSION;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in nfsstat01
>  nfsx-linux export VERSION SOCKET_TYPE; TCbin=$LTPROOT/testcases/bin
> fsx.sh
